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83327563 95297247 144308733
3354350 4877625404 442
3354350 4877625404 442
80790 3915063069 335630177 05 352950
All about undefined
Interested in learning more?
3354350 4877625404 442
80790 3915063069 335630177 05 352950
See more
649316552 62534722 4895611375
7801415 70715 9782 626472
See more
465521 8456671
39278 132 866595130
See more